

本文属于机器翻译版本。若本译文内容与英语原文存在差异，则一律以英文原文为准。

# `pcluster 更新集群`
<a name="pcluster.update-cluster-v3"></a>

更新现有集群以匹配指定配置文件的设置。

**注意**  
 只有当所有群集节点都成功应用更新时，群集更新才会成功。如果更新失败，请参阅故障排除指南[`集群状态为` `UPDATE_FAILED`](troubleshooting-fc-v3-update-cluster.md#update-cluster-failure-v3)部分。

```
pcluster update-cluster [-h] 
                 --cluster-configuration {{CLUSTER_CONFIGURATION}}
                 --cluster-name {{CLUSTER_NAME}}
                [--debug]
                [--dryrun {{DRYRUN}}]
                [--force-update {{FORCE_UPDATE}}]
                [--query {{QUERY}}]
                [--region {{REGION}}]
                [--suppress-validators {{SUPPRESS_VALIDATORS}} [{{SUPPRESS_VALIDATORS}} ...]]
                [--validation-failure-level {INFO,WARNING,ERROR}]
```

## 命名的参数
<a name="pcluster-v3.update-cluster.namedargs"></a>

**-h, --help**  
显示 `pcluster update-cluster` 的帮助文本。

**--cluster-configuration, -c {{CLUSTER\_CONFIGURATION}}**  
指定 YAML 集群配置文件。

**--cluster-name, -n {{CLUSTER\_NAME}}**  
指定集群的名称。

**--debug**  
启用调试日志记录。

**--dryrun {{DRYRUN}}**  
当为 `true` 时，执行验证而不更新集群和创建任何资源。它可用于验证映像配置和更新要求。（默认值为 `false`。）

**--force-update {{FORCE\_UPDATE}}**  
当为 `true` 时，通过忽略更新验证错误强制更新。（默认值为 `false`。）

**--query {{QUERY}}**  
指定要对输出执行的 JMESPath 查询。

**--region, -r {{REGION}}**  
指定 Amazon Web Services 区域 要使用的。 Amazon Web Services 区域 必须使用群集配置文件中的[`Region`](cluster-configuration-file-v3.md#yaml-Region)设置、`AWS_DEFAULT_REGION`环境变量、`~/.aws/config`文件`[default]`部分的`region`设置或`--region`参数来指定。

**--suppress-validators {{ SUPPRESS\_VALIDATORS}} [{{SUPPRESS\_VALIDATORS ...}}]**  
标识一个或多个要禁止的配置验证器。  
格式：(`ALL`\|`type:[A-Za-z0-9]+`)

**--validation-failure-level {{{INFO,WARNING,ERROR}}}**  
指定为更新报告的验证失败级别。

**使用 Amazon ParallelCluster 版本 3.1.4 的示例：**

```
$ pcluster update-cluster -c {{cluster-config.yaml}} -n {{cluster-v3}} -r {{us-east-1}}
{
  "cluster": {
    "clusterName": "cluster-v3",
    "cloudformationStackStatus": "UPDATE_IN_PROGRESS",
    "cloudformationStackArn": "arn:aws:cloudformation:us-east-1:123456789012:stack/cluster-v3/1234abcd-56ef-78gh-90ij-abcd1234efgh",
    "region": "us-east-1",
    "version": "3.1.4",
    "clusterStatus": "UPDATE_IN_PROGRESS"
  },
  "changeSet": [
    {
      "parameter": "HeadNode.Iam.S3Access",
      "requestedValue": {
        "BucketName": "amzn-s3-demo-bucket1",
        "KeyName": "output",
        "EnableWriteAccess": false
      }
    },
    {
      "parameter": "HeadNode.Iam.S3Access",
      "currentValue": {
        "BucketName": "amzn-s3-demo-bucket2",
        "KeyName": "logs",
        "EnableWriteAccess": true
      }
    }
  ]
}
```